AI-powered collaborative robots for safer, easier automation
Doosan Robotics is a South Korea-based collaborative robot manufacturer founded in 2015. It builds the M-series cobots including the M0617 and related models such as A0509 and E0605, and markets them for industrial automation use cases. The company positions itself around safety, ease of use, and AI-powered solutions, and operates globally through its own site and distributor channels.
